Ballard Mortgage/TAXPRO on the move to Fishermen’s Terminal next month

Ballard Mortgage/TAXPRO (corner of 15th Ave NW and 58th St) will be moving to new offices at Fishermen’s Terminal (1711 Nickerson St, Suite A) from May 1.

The company, founded in its Ballard location by its President Mitch Day in 1998, offers locals professional tax preparation and representation. “The move to Fisherman’s Terminal (Nordby Building) allows the company to continue to serve the Ballard, Magnolia and Queen Anne neighborhoods,” says Day.

Locals may remember the original Ballard Mortgage, which grew to one of the largest mortgage companies in Washington. The business was was sold many years ago to an east coast company, allowing Day to use the name when he was organizing his company.

Day is a Washington licensed Mortgage Loan Officer and Ballard Mortgage is a Washington licensed Mortgage Broker;  Day is also an Enrolled Agent, licensed by the US Treasury and may represent taxpayers before the IRS.
